CITIC Telecom International Holdings Limited - Marketing Mix: Product

CITIC Telecom International Holdings Limited offers a wide range of comprehensive telecommunications solutions tailored to meet the diverse needs of its customers. Below are the critical components of their product offering:

Comprehensive Telecom Solutions

CITIC Telecom provides an integrated suite of telecom services designed for both enterprise and retail markets. The company's solutions cover fixed-line, mobile, and data services, catering to businesses across various sectors. In the fiscal year 2022, CITIC Telecom reported revenues of approximately HKD 10.23 billion (around USD 1.31 billion) from its telecom services, indicating a robust demand for their offerings.

Data and Internet Services

Data services include broadband and leased line solutions, with the company emphasizing high-speed and reliable connectivity. For instance, CITIC Telecom's broadband services have reached over 1.3 million subscribers as of the end of 2022. The growth in broadband subscribers is reflected in the annual revenue of approximately HKD 4.5 billion (around USD 575 million) generated from data and internet services.
Service Type Subscriber Count Annual Revenue (HKD) Annual Revenue (USD)
Broadband Services 1,300,000 4,500,000,000 575,000,000
Leased Line Services 150,000 1,200,000,000 153,000,000

Enterprise Cloud Solutions

CITIC Telecom offers cloud services that provide businesses with scalable resources, including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S) and Software as a Service (SaaS). The company reported a 30% growth in its cloud services revenue year-on-year, amounting to HKD 900 million (approximately USD 115 million) for 2022. This growth is driven by increased demand for digital transformation in enterprises.

International Voice Services

CITIC Telecom has established a strong position in international voice services, catering to both retail and enterprise clients. In 2022, the company processed over 3.5 billion minutes of international voice calls, contributing approximately HKD 2.2 billion (around USD 282 million) to the overall revenue. Their extensive global network and partnerships with leading telecom providers enhance their service offerings.
Service Type Minutes Processed (Billion) Annual Revenue (HKD) Annual Revenue (USD)
International Voice Services 3.5 2,200,000,000 282,000,000

Mobile Services and Applications

CITIC Telecom's mobile services include postpaid and prepaid subscriptions, mobile data, and value-added services. As of 2022, the company had over 2 million mobile subscribers. Mobile services revenue reached HKD 1.8 billion (roughly USD 230 million) for the year, driven by the growing adoption of smartphones and mobile applications.
Service Type Subscriber Count Annual Revenue (HKD) Annual Revenue (USD)
Postpaid Mobile Services 1,200,000 1,200,000,000 153,000,000
Prepaid Mobile Services 800,000 600,000,000 77,000,000

CITIC Telecom International Holdings Limited - Marketing Mix: Price

CITIC Telecom International Holdings Limited adopts various pricing strategies to maintain its competitive edge in the telecommunications industry.

Competitive Pricing Strategies

CITIC Telecom utilizes competitive pricing strategies to align its prices with or slightly below market averages, thereby attracting price-sensitive customers. As per the latest data, the average revenue per user (ARPU) in the Hong Kong telecom sector is approximately HKD 137. This serves as a benchmark for CITIC's pricing strategy.

Tiered Service Plans

CITIC Telecom offers tiered service plans that cater to different customer segments. These plans include: | Service Tier | Monthly Fee (HKD) | Data Allowance | Voice Calls | |-----------------------|------------------|-----------------|-------------------| | Basic Plan | 198 | 10 GB | Unlimited Local | | Standard Plan | 298 | 30 GB | Unlimited Local | | Premium Plan | 498 | 100 GB | Unlimited Local + International To 10 Destinations | These plans are designed to provide flexibility and ensure customers select the option that best fits their usage patterns.

Volume Discounts for Enterprises

CITIC Telecom extends volume discounts for enterprise clients, which is a significant portion of their revenue stream. In 2022, the company reported that enterprise solutions accounted for 60% of their total revenue, contributing to HKD 2.1 billion. Discounts typically range from 10% to 25%, based on contract size and length. | Discount Tier | Contract Value (HKD) | Discount Percentage | |-----------------------|------------------------|----------------------| | Tier 1 | 100,000 - 500,000 | 10% | | Tier 2 | 500,001 - 1,000,000 | 15% | | Tier 3 | 1,000,001 and above | 25% |

Bundling Offers for Cross-Services

CITIC Telecom promotes bundling offers which combine mobile, fixed-line, and internet services. The bundling strategy aims to enhance perceived value and customer retention. For instance, a bundle including fixed broadband and mobile service is typically priced at HKD 399, offering savings of up to HKD 150 compared to purchasing services separately. | Bundle Type | Components | Price (HKD) | Savings (HKD) | |-----------------------|--------------------------------|-------------------|---------------------| | Mobile + Broadband | 30 GB Mobile + 100 Mbps Fiber | 399 | 150 | | Mobile + Fixed Line | Unlimited Mobile + Unlimited Local | 299 | 100 | | Triple Play | 30 GB Mobile + 100 Mbps Fiber + Fixed Line | 599 | 250 |

Flexible Payment Terms

To enhance accessibility, CITIC Telecom implements flexible payment terms. Customers can opt to pay monthly, quarterly, or an annual fee, with a slight discount for those choosing annual payments. The discount for annual payment is typically around 10%. | Payment Plan | Frequency | Amount (HKD) | Discount Percentage | |-----------------------|----------------------|-------------------|----------------------| | Monthly | Monthly | 299 | 0% | | Quarterly | Every 3 Months | 849 | 5% | | Annual | Once a Year | 3,240 | 10% | CITIC Telecom's pricing strategies are structured to provide comprehensive value to its clients while maintaining competitiveness in a dynamic market.
